#1db1c2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1db1c2 is composed of 11.4% red, 69.4%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.1% cyan, 8.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 23.9% black. It has a hue angle of 186.2 degrees, a saturation of 74% and a lightness of 43.7%. #1db1c2 color hex could be obtained by blending #3affff with #006385. Closest websafe color is: #3399cc.

#1db1c2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1db1c2 has RGB values of R:29, G:177, B:194 and CMYK values of C:0.85, M:0.09, Y:0, K:0.24. Its decimal value is 1946050.
